Introduction

XT4052 is a complete single-chip linear power management IC for lithium-ion battery constant-current/constant-voltage charging. Its slim profile and compact package make it ideal for portable applications. The chip is designed to comply with USB power supply specifications. Thanks to the internal MOSFET architecture, no external sense resistors or blocking diodes are required. During high-power operation and elevated ambient temperatures, thermal feedback regulates the charge current to reduce die temperature. The charge voltage is fixed at 4.2V, and the charge current is programmable via an external resistor. When the charge voltage reaches the target value and the charge current drops to 1/10 of the programmed value, the chip automatically terminates charging. When the input power source is removed, the chip automatically enters a low-current state, reducing battery leakage current to below 2μA. The XT4052 can also be placed in shutdown mode, in which the supply current drops to 25μA. The chip integrates a battery reverse-polarity protection circuit to prevent IC breakdown and avoid accidents caused by battery self-discharge. Additional features include charge current monitoring, input undervoltage lockout, automatic recharge, and charge status indication.

Features

  • Programmable charge current up to 800mA
  • No external MOSFET, sense resistor, or blocking diode required
  • Complete Li-ion battery linear charge management in small form factor
  • CC/CV operation with thermal regulation for efficient battery management without overheating risk
  • Single-cell Li-ion battery charging from USB port
  • Preset charge voltage 4.2V ±1%
  • Charge current output monitoring
  • Charge status indication
  • Charge termination at 1/10 charge current
  • 25μA supply current in shutdown mode
  • 2.9V trickle charge threshold voltage
  • Soft-start to limit inrush current
  • Reverse battery protection
